1 John 2:15-17
15 Don’t love this evil world or the things in it. If you love the world, you do not have the love of the Father in you.
16 This is all there is in the world: wanting to please our sinful selves, wanting the sinful things we see, and being too proud of what we have. But none of these comes from the Father. They come from the world.
17 The world is passing away, and all the things that people want in the world are passing away. But whoever does what God wants will live forever.
